Common TikTok Marketing Mistakes to Avoid in 2026
TikTok offers incredible opportunities for creators and businesses, but many accounts struggle to grow because of avoidable mistakes. By understanding these common errors, you can improve your content strategy and achieve better results.
1. Posting Inconsistently
Uploading videos only occasionally makes it difficult to build momentum. Create a content schedule and stick to it.
2. Ignoring the First Few Seconds
If your opening isn't interesting, viewers will quickly scroll away. Start every video with a strong hook.
3. Using Low-Quality Videos
Clear visuals, good lighting, and crisp audio help your content appear more professional and engaging.
4. Ignoring Audience Engagement
Reply to comments and interact with your followers regularly to build a loyal community.
5. Using Irrelevant Hashtags
Choose hashtags that match your content instead of adding random trending hashtags.
6. Copying Every Trend
Trends can help, but always add your own creativity and personality to stand out.
7. Not Reviewing Analytics
TikTok Analytics provides valuable insights into your audience, watch time, and engagement. Use this data to improve future content.
